Describes the electronic control gear for use on a.c. and d.c. supplies up to 1000 V at 50 Hz or 60 Hz with operating frequencies deviating from the supply frequency, associated with fluorescent lamps as specified in IEC 60081 and IEC 60901, and other fluorescent lamps for high-frequency operation.
